Metallic kagome systems have raised in the recent years as a new type of materials hosting topological flat bands, Dirac crossings and van Hove singularities that give rise to intertwined charge density waves (CDW), magnetism and superconductivity. In this proposal, we want to measure the low energy phonon spectra associated with the single-qCDW in the twisted bilayer kagome net YCo6Ge6. We intend to comprehensively measure the temperature and momentum dependence of the low energy acoustic and optical phonons by means of high-resolution inelastic x-ray scattering (IXS). Our preliminary diffuse scattering data detected precursors located in the plane with odd L=1, 3, 5 that might be related to the critical role of chemical bond instability, phonon softening or the order-disorder character of the pre-translational fluctuations.
